云端MSSQL —— 助力数据处理(云 mssql)

随着科技日新月异,云计算技术正越来越受到欢迎,成为企业信息化服务的重要组成部分。云端MSSQL是一个服务器类数据库管理系统,它将多个企业数据库部署在网络上,分布于多个节点计算机上,用于共享用户数据。它是基于Microsoft SQL Server的数据库,可以支持业务的快速高效开发,同时也具有较强的稳定性,以及可靠的数据安全保护功能。

首先,云端MSSQL可以实现数据库服务虚拟化,也就是在虚拟机中部署数据库,使得服务器上的数据库具有更强的可用性和灵活性,因此可以更容易地实现更高级的功能。其次,MSSQL的迁移变得更加容易,因为云端MSSQL将企业数据库部署在网络上,支持数据的快速迁移,可以极大地提高数据迁移的效率。

此外,云端MSSQL的开发环境也让编程变得更加简单。它支持多种编程语言,包括Java、PHP、C#等,以及基于Microsoft创建的T-SQL,可以减少开发成本,也可以极大地提高开发效率。此外,还支持跨平台开发,可以在各大操作系统上部署同一个云MSSQL,节省本地资源和成本,大大提高企业预算效率。另外,MSSQL还支持多种数据库,如SQL Server、MySQL等,可以把多个数据库集成在一起,更好地实现数据的搜索、处理和分析。

例如下面的代码可以展示使用MSSQL实现数据库迁移的过程:

String connectionString =”server=databaseName;uid=username;pwd=password;”;

using (SqlConnection con = new SqlConnection(connectionString);

{

SqlCommand cmd = new SqlCommand(“SELECT * FROM source_db”, con);

SqlDataAdapter adapter = new SqlDataAdapter(cmd);

DataTable dt = new DataTable();

adapter.Fill(dt);

//Open destination db connection

SqlConnection destinationCon = new SqlConnection(destinationString);

destinationCon.Open();

//Bulk copy from DataTable to destination db

using (SqlBulkCopy sbc = new SqlBulkCopy(destinationCon))

{

sbc.DestinationTableName = “destination_db”;

sbc.BatchSize = 1000;

sbc.WriteToServer(dt);

}

//Close open connection

destinationCon.Close();

}

总而言之,通过采用MSSQL,企业可以实现高效、安全且可拓展性强的数据处理,提高服务质量,同时也可以降低信息化解决方案的成本。让IT专家们可以以更加简单的方式快速部署企业的数据库系统,可以说云端MSSQL的出现有利于促进了当前企业数据处理的发展。


数据运维技术 » 云端MSSQL —— 助力数据处理(云 mssql)